CertifiedLabsA Food Intolerance Package is a blood test which is used for identifying particular food intolerances that can cause various uncomfortable symptoms. Unlike food allergies, which can trigger severe reactions, food intolerances usually result in milder symptoms that may develop hours after consuming certain foods. Common symptoms of food intolerance include bloating, gas, diarrhoea, abdominal pain, fatigue, skin rashes, and headaches. Even though these symptoms are less intense, they can greatly impact your daily life.
This test requires a simple blood sample. It checks your body’s reaction to various foods by measuring specific antibodies known as IgG. These antibodies are generated when your body responds to specific foods that it struggles to digest. The Food Intolerance package evaluates an extensive range of food groups, including dairy, seafood, nuts, grains, fruits, and vegetables, encompassing 10 categories and testing for a total of 177 different allergens.
By identifying your food intolerances, you can make informed dietary decisions that help you avoid discomfort and improve your overall well-being. If you regularly experience digestive problems or other reactions after meals, getting a food intolerance test could be helpful. This proactive measure can assist you in discovering which foods might be causing your symptoms, leading to a healthier and more comfortable lifestyle.

Food intolerance symptoms can develop hours after eating certain foods, making it difficult to identify the specific triggers. Disorders such as ir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) and inflammatory bowel disease (IBD) can increase vulnerability to food sensitivities.
This checkup is suggested for those who suffer from the following symptoms of food intolerance:
Abdominal discomfort
Diarrhoea
Bloating and gas
Severe headaches or migraines
Heartburn or acid reflux
Nausea
Upset stomach
Understanding food intolerances is crucial because it allows you to remove or minimise problematic foods from your diet, leading to improved comfort and better digestive health.
